We're having a weird intermittent problem with our Kohler shower.

The shower is a Kohler Finial with a Rite-Temp 1/2" pressure-balancing valve K-304-KS-NA. We shower with the handle in the full on position. At times, the shower output will begin to slow down after a few minutes almost to a stop. The "fix" is to turn the handle to a full off and then to again bring it back to a full on and it starts working again though sometimes it will again slow down to a stop in less than a minute and you have to repeat the off-on movement with the handle.

The other thing to mention is that if someone else uses the shower after a few minutes, they don't see the problem.

And by intermittent, I mean every other week or so.

We had a plumber in but the shower was on its best behavior during his visit so had only our description to go by. He replaced the the mixer cap and the pressure balancing unit (PBU) but the problem resumed a few days later.

Any suggestions?

Is this with a mix of hot and cold water running, not full hot or full cold? Have you removed the shower head? When it happens, just remove the shower head without touching the valve. You may want to keep an adjustable wrench or pliers next to the shower.
